HCI UART driver
CONFIG_BLUEZ_HCIUART
Bluetooth HCI UART driver.
This driver is required if you want to use Bluetooth devices with
serial port interface. You will also need this driver if you have
UART based Bluetooth PCMCIA and CF devices like Xircom Credit Card
adapter and BrainBoxes Bluetooth PC Card.
Say Y here to compile support for Bluetooth UART devices into the
kernel or say M to compile it as module (hci_uart.o).
HCI UART (H4) protocol support
CONFIG_BLUEZ_HCIUART_H4
UART (H4) is serial protocol for communication between Bluetooth
device and host. This protocol is required for most UART based
Bluetooth device (including PCMCIA and CF).
Say Y here to compile support for HCI UART (H4) protocol.
HCI USB driver
CONFIG_BLUEZ_HCIUSB
Bluetooth HCI USB driver.
This driver is required if you want to use Bluetooth devices with
USB interface.
Say Y here to compile support for Bluetooth USB devices into the
kernel or say M to compile it as module (hci_usb.o).
HCI USB firmware download support
CONFIG_BLUEZ_USB_FW_LOAD
Firmware download support for Bluetooth USB devices.
This support is required for devices like Broadcom BCM2033.
HCI USB driver uses external firmware downloader program provided
in BlueFW package.
For more information, see <http://bluez.sf.net/>.
HCI USB zero packet support
CONFIG_BLUEZ_USB_ZERO_PACKET
Support for USB zero packets.
This option is provided only as a work around for buggy Bluetooth USB
devices. Do _not_ enable it unless you know for sure that your device
requires zero packets.
Most people should say N here.
HCI VHCI Virtual HCI device driver
CONFIG_BLUEZ_HCIVHCI
Bluetooth Virtual HCI device driver.
This driver is required if you want to use HCI Emulation software.
Say Y here to compile support for virtual HCI devices into the
kernel or say M to compile it as module (hci_vhci.o).
HCI DTL1 (PC Card) device driver
CONFIG_BLUEZ_HCIDTL1
Bluetooth HCI DTL1 (PC Card) driver.
This driver provides support for Bluetooth PCMCIA devices with
Nokia DTL1 interface:
Nokia Bluetooth Card
Socket Bluetooth CF Card
Say Y here to compile support for HCI DTL1 devices into the
kernel or say M to compile it as module (dtl1_cs.o).
HCI BlueCard (PC Card) device driver
CONFIG_BLUEZ_HCIBLUECARD
Bluetooth HCI BlueCard (PC Card) driver.
This driver provides support for Bluetooth PCMCIA devices with
Anycom BlueCard interface:
Anycom Bluetooth PC Card
Anycom Bluetooth CF Card
Say Y here to compile support for HCI BlueCard devices into the
kernel or say M to compile it as module (bluecard_cs.o).
